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 package ladyfingers (about 24 pieces)
  • 2 cups mixed berries (raspberries, strawberries, blueberries)
  • 2 cups vanilla custard
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• Fresh mint leaves for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Custard: In a saucepan, whisk together 2 cups milk, 1/2 cup sugar, 4 egg yolks, 2 tablespoons cornstarch, and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ract over medium heat until thickened. Cool completely.
  2. Whip the Cream: Beat 1 cup heavy whipping cream with 2 tablespoons powdered sugar until soft peaks form. Reserve some for topping.
  3. Layer the Trifle: In a large glass dish or individual cups, layer ladyfingers at the bottom, followed by custard and mixed berries. Repeat layers until filled.
  4. Top with Whipped Cream: Spread remaining whipped cream over the top layer and garnish with mint leaves.
  5. Chill: Cover and refrigerate for at least two hours before serving.
